If the Lagrangian of a particle moving in one dimensions is given by L= \(\frac{\dot x^2}{2x}\) - V(x), the Hamiltonian is

1
\(\frac{1}{2}\) xp2 + V(x)
2
\(\frac{x^2}{2x}\) + V(x)
3
\(\frac{1}{2}\) x2 + V(x)
4
\(\frac{p^2}{2x}\) + V(x)
